Abstract
OBJECTIVE To investigate the effect of Erfukang oral liquid on hearing loss, hearing reflex and transient evoked otoacoustic emission (TEOAE) in guinea pigs with gentamicin induced hearing loss. METHODS The guinea pigs were randomly divided into control group, model group, Erlongzuociwan group (2.7 g·kg-1), high, medium and low dose of Erfukang oral solution group (18, 9, 4.5 mL·kg-1). In addition to the control group daily intramuscular injection of 2 mL·kg-1saline, other groups were given daily intramuscular gentamicin sulfate 80 mg·kg-1, and given the corresponding drugs by gavage, injection (intragastric administration of drugs and injection of gentamicin was 14 d), auditory ears reflected in seventh day and fourteenth day after administration were tested, fifteenth day guinea pigs in each TEOAE testing. RESULTS Effect of gentamicin induced auditory auditory reflex in the deafness model of guinea pig:on the seventh day, hearing ear reflected, the control group and the model group had significant difference (P<0.01), each dose group of Erfukang oral liquid dosage group compared with model group had significant difference (P<0.01). The influence of TEOAE model of gentamicin induced deafness in guinea pig ear:total reaction energy of each dose group of Erfukang oral liquid decreased significantly compared with control group(P<0.05 or P<0.01); and correlation of each dose group of Erfukang oral liquid significantly decreased(P<0.05 or P<0.01). CONCLUSION The treatment of Erfukang on which hearing loss caused by gentamicin in guinea pigs has improved effect.
